  1. Pick out a base

If you have at any time frequented Chipotle or any rapid services restaurant that allows you establish your own bowl, you probable know that most bowls typically get started with a grain. Chipotle presents brown or white rice. Other destinations may well start off with quinoa or farro. 

Commence there with your bowl. Aside from rice, quinoa and farro, check out bulgur wheat, wheatberries, spelt, amaranth, or even cooked oats. Entire grains are complicated carbs that have a great deal of protein and fiber, both of those of which hold you whole. Make sure you consider the part measurement of any grain. Ordinarily, ½ cup to 1 cup of cooked grains is a great deal. 

Or if you want to skip the grain, begin your bowl with a leafy green. [ Related: How To Add More Leafy Greens Into Your Plant-Based Diet] Chopped kale, spinach, butter leaf lettuce, swiss chard, blended greens, purple leaf lettuce or blended lettuce are just some of the environmentally friendly alternatives. 

  1. Increase a protein 

A plant-based protein may possibly be a single of the most vital features of a healthful bowl. Protein contributes to muscle expansion and hunger handle. In other text, adding protein to your bowl will enable maintain you entire for hrs. 

Decide on from the next list of plant-dependent proteins. Far better however, blend and match a couple of of these:

  • Tofu, Protein: 9 grams in 3 ounces (⅕ of a block)
  • Seitan, Protein: 21 grams in ⅓ cup (1 ounce)
  • Tempeh, Protein: 16 grams in 3 ounces
  • Edamame, Protein: 9 grams of protein in ½ cup
  • Black beans, Protein: 14 grams in 1 cup (canned)
  • Lentils, Protein: 13 grams in ½ cup cooked
  • Hemp seeds, Protein: 10 grams in 3 tablespoons
  • Peas, Protein: 5 grams in ⅔ cup
  • Amaranth, Protein: 6 grams in ⅔ cup (cooked)
  • Oats, Protein: 5 grams in 1/2 cup of dry oats
  • Quinoa, Protein: 8 grams of protein in 1 cup cooked
  • Chickpeas, Protein: 12 grams in 1 cup (canned)
  • White beans, Protein: 12 grams in 1 cup (canned)
  • Kidney beans, Protein: 14 grams in 1 cup (canned)
  • Flax seeds, Protein: 8 grams in 3 tablespoons
  • Black-eyed peas, Protein: 14 grams in 1 cup (canned)
  1. Incorporate veggies (and/or fruit)

Veggies and fruit are not only nutrition powerhouses, they are also packed with flavor. Not to mention that there are so several versions to pick out from. Choose for raw veggies, like shredded cabbage, sliced peppers, diced carrots or chopped onion. Or blend veggies with olive oil and salt and roast them in the oven. Some of my favorites to roast are sweet potatoes, cauliflower, broccoli, beets and environmentally friendly beans. 

And if you want some purely natural sweetness to enhance the other nutty and savory flavors, add chopped fruit. Tomatoes, avocados and zucchini are all regarded a fruit. But there are other sweet options, like apples, peaches, blueberries, strawberries, watermelon and a lot more!  

  1. Pick out your toppings

Now arrives the fun part– the toppings! The next addition to your bowl provides texture and taste. In the Chipotle case in point, a person of the biggest glitches os choosing calorie dense toppings, like sour cream or loads of cheese.

In its place, sprinkle your bowl with seeds or nuts. Some of my go-to’s include: 

  • Pumpkin seeds
  • Sunflower seeds
  • Flax seeds
  • Hemp seeds
  • Chopped toasted almonds
  • Chopped walnuts
  • Chopped peanuts

Or improve the veggie intake ever even more and increase sliced radishes or a homemade pico de gallo or guacamole. 

  1. Sauce it up

I believed about which include sauce in the toppings, but I imagine sauces must stand on their have. They are actually what make or split your dish and insert a big taste element. And remember, the toppings include texture, though the sauces contribute flavor. 

You can quickly use a bottled sauce, like a teriyaki, sriracha, balsamic glaze, salad dressing or even a dip, like hummus, salsa tzatziki. Or you can make your have sauce. Some of my favorites include things like a homemade honey mustard, lemon pepper marinade, balsamic vinaigrette, romanesco and pesto. 

Just like the rest of your bowl, the sauce choices are limitless.

Improve the flavor

The sauces are definitely a flavor increase, but there are many other techniques to add taste to your bowl. These are some solutions: 

  • Roast your veggies in spices, like cumin, chili powder, cinnamon, aged bay seasoning, curry powder or smoked paprika. 
  • Utilize herbs, like chopped cilantro, basil, parsley, oregano, thyme, rosemary, mint and others. A small bit of herbs goes a prolonged way. 
  • If you can handle the warmth, increase chopped chilies, like jalapenos, serrano or habaneros. 
  • A small little bit of diced chives or scallions can seriously up the taste recreation.
  • Drizzle the bowl with olive oil and a squeeze of lime juice. Better nonetheless, use garlic marinated olive oil.

Double up the protein

If you’re teaching for an athletic celebration, like a marathon or triathlon, chances are you want much more protein to fulfill your calorie and muscle mass requirements. Or you may possibly be a power-experienced athlete wanting for increase muscle gains. 

Whatever the cause, expanding the protein in your plant-centered bowl can be a great notion. Include a double serving of tofu, legumes, beans or seeds. That claimed, unless your caloric requirements are increased, you’ll very likely want to slice back on some of the grains, toppings or sauces, so the calories stay the very same. 

Carb load

Stamina athletes might require more carbs than the ordinary man or woman, and the normal ½-1 cup of whole grains may not slash it. If you are carb loading for a race or instruction at every day substantial depth, enhance the carbs in your bowl. [Realted: How To Carb Load For A Race}

Double up on the grain or vegetable portion of the bowl for more carbs. Some plant-based proteins, like beans or lentils, also include plenty of carbs. Just be careful not to overdo it on the fiber and cause digestive issues.
